What worked for me was leaving the line "HIICrc32=" no quotes, with the checksum after the = removed in the BIOS config file.

 

This is my T620 BIOS config file (v2.19 BIOS), tested with ThinPro v7.1 today

 

bios.JPG

 

 

 

 

HP Recommended

Amazing, that fixed it!
I totally missed that there was a CRC32 hash in the file (no other forum topics or documentation mentioned this either).

Important to note, it didn't work when I only had the bit with the wakeonlan, it did require me to have a full bios-export.
